    Default Bruce Lee vs. Kirby

    It comes time for Bruce Lee and Kirby to fight in their tournament match.

    The two are taken to a course consisting of a set of docks, with a beach underneath.

    Lee bows at Kirby. Kirby nods back.



    The two spend a few moments gauging each other, Lee due to his training, Kirby due to experience--one does not win a boss fight simply through reflex. However, Kirby makes the first move with a flying kick. Bruce Lee dodges and manages to land a swift blow to Kirby from behind. Kirby feels it. He knows five more hits like that will take him down.

    As soon as Kirby lands, Lee tries to press his advantage. Kirby quickly guards, preventing any damage. Lee backs off a moment. Kirby charges forward and tries his signature move. He sucks.

    Lee jumps over the short puff. Kirby quickly realizes his mistake. He turns just in time for Lee to hit two swift kicks. Kirby is knocked off the dock. Fortunately for him, there's a small boulder nearby. Before his opponent can join him, Kirby sucks up the rock. He swallows and becomes Stone Kirby! Lee tries to land a falling kick as he jumps to the beach below. He uses the power to transform.



    Bruce Lee kicks the rock. The blow harms neither of them. Lee jumps away, seeking a more comfortable landing. He waits for Kirby to transform. Moments pass. Cautiously, Lee decides to approach the rock. Suddenly, Kirby returns to normal! He squats and ejects a large star from his body. Lee seizes the opportunity to strike. He succeeds, his blow knocking Kirby across the sand.

    Kirby springs back up and sucks in the bouncing star. Lee charges toward him. Kirby exhales, hitting Lee with the star. While his opponent is stunned, Kirby sucks up a second rock and fires it at Lee. He does it a third time. Each time, he gets steadily closer. Until... he inhales and is close enough to inhale Lee himself! Kirby squats, absorbs Lee's power, and ejects him.



    Now he becomes a special customized version of Fighter Kirby that looks quite a bit like Bruce Lee himself. This certainly takes Lee for surprise.

    To onlookers, this becomes a fight of great interest. The two seem in perfect sync. If one punches, the other blocks. If one kicks, the other moves. If one jumps, the other can grab ahold and toss him to the ground. However, Kirby has one thing in his favor. He's tiny. He is able to land some blows because his arms are able to fly faster and hit quicker than Lee's.

    After a few moments, Lee backs off. He's winded. He can feel bruises growing on his skin. But he knows he cannot cease. He must win. He steadies himself. As soon as Kirby charges, Lee feigns a kick, forcing Kirby to jump. He then hits the pink puff with a solid chop.

    The hit makes Kirby lose his special power. The power, now in the form of a star, bounces away, hits the water, and shatters. Kirby is exhausted. He knows he can only take one more blow. But he can't get up. He's too tired.

    Bruce Lee apologizes for what he must do. He charges forward, planning to unleash one last drop kick.

    Kirby notices a nearby crab with spikes on it. It reminds him of a Pichikuri.

    Lee's kick misses because Kirby rolls away. He quickly sucks up the crab, squats, and hopes it gives him a new power. He and Lee rush at each other. A moment later, just as Lee is about to land a blow using the base of his palm, Kirby tenses up. Spikes suddenly protrude from his body! Where once Lee expected to hit flesh, he is met by a hardened needle instead. Needless to say, the needle hurts. Kirby presses his advantage. Lee receives slice upon slice from spike after spike.

    Finally, Kirby ejects his Needle power and takes a deep breath. Kirby musters up as much strength as he can. Kirby grabs the weakened Bruce Lee by the collar. Kirby jumps high into the air. Kirby slams his opponent into the sand.

    Tired, and with great sadness, Kirby stands victorious.
